HOW TO GET OVER BAD GOALS:
Develop some ritual, for example skate to a corner and back or lift your helmet and take a drink. Also think about them ahead of time. What it feels like and then figure out a way how to handle them. After all life will continue, goals will go in and the most likely the sun will still rise next day. So what is the worst thing that can happen? You didn't give a chance for your team to win but if you have done everything you can do play as good as you can there is not a reason to feel bad. If you have prepared for the game as good as you can and try your best that is all you can do. Just try to enjoy the game, even it is easier said than done.

It is all about the preparation. If you practice enought and make consistently the saves at practices and for some reason not at games it is how you have prepared for the game.
100 000 repetitions make a movemet automatic and then it is all about how you have prepared for the game.
Off ice warm up it crucial for pratices and games too. If you are from North America I know you guys never do it. For example Miikka Kiprusoff would not be able to do what he does if he didn't do it. Off ice is not only for the body also for your mind too.
